When your dog suddenly starts choking on a toy or gets injured during your evening walk, every second counts. As a dog owner, you are your pet's first line of defense in medical emergencies. While nothing replaces professional veterinary care, knowing basic first aid can mean the difference between life and death for your beloved companion. Why Dog First Aid Knowledge Is Critical for Every Pet Owner According to the American Pet Products Association, over 70 million US households own dogs. Yet most pet parents feel helpless when faced with a medical emergency. Unlike human first aid, dogs cannot tell us where it hurts or what happened. They rely entirely on our ability to recognize distress signals and respond appropriately. Emergency veterinary visits cost an average of $800–$1,500, but the real tragedy occurs when preventable injuries become life-threatening due to delayed or improper initial care.
